Consumer protection; automatic renewal or continuous service offers, disclosure and cancellation.
What changed between versions
A new section was added establishing that violations of the chapter are prohibited practices subject to the Virginia Consumer Protection Act, while providing a potential exemption for suppliers making a good faith effort to comply.
The definition of 'clear and conspicuous' for print publications was moved into brackets, indicating it is a house amendment that may be optional or subject to further review compared to the electronic platform requirements.
The requirement for simple cancellation mechanisms was modified for offers initiated in person or via print, removing the mandatory 'in addition to' language and placing the requirement in brackets to indicate a change in how these specific scenarios must be handled.
The text describing the sections of the Code of Virginia being amended was updated to include the new 59.1-207.49 section, expanding the bill's formal scope.
